Sphere Entertainment Co. operates in the live entertainment and media industry with two main segments: Sphere and MSG Networks. The Sphere segment features a high-tech entertainment venue in Las Vegas known as the Sphere, which offers a multi-sensory experience for various events such as concerts and corporate gatherings. Revenue is generated through ticket sales, sponsorships, and advertising on the venue's exterior, called the Exosphere. The MSG Networks segment includes regional sports and entertainment channels, MSG Network and MSG Sportsnet, along with a streaming service called MSG+. This segment earns revenue mainly from affiliation fees charged to distributors and advertising. Sphere Entertainment Co. distinguishes itself from competitors by combining a unique venue experience with a strong regional sports presence, aiming to provide diverse entertainment options for audiences and partners.

MPQA is excited to congratulate AED Product Development led by MPQA board member Bryan Robertus as they have been acquired by Sphere Entertainment Co.
Sphere Entertainment Co. has acquired AED Product Development, a firm known for its expertise in high-resolution imaging and content creation technologies. AED, founded in 1994, is recognized for its work on the Big Sky camera system, used for Sphere's advanced LED screen. This acquisition will enhance Sphere's R&D capabilities, accelerating innovations in visual technologies.
